Planning a trip to the beautiful city of Paris? One of the must-visit attractions in Paris is the Louvre Museum, home to some of the world’s most famous art pieces.
With over 35,000 works of art on display, including the iconic Mona Lisa, the Louvre Museum is a treasure trove for art enthusiasts and history buffs alike.
Exploring the Louvre Museum
Once you step inside the grandiose building, you’ll be greeted by the stunning glass pyramid entrance, which has become a symbol of the museum. As you wander through the museum’s vast halls, you’ll encounter works from various periods, ranging from ancient Egyptian artifacts to Renaissance masterpieces.
One of the highlights of a visit to the Louvre Museum is seeing the famous Mona Lisa by Leonardo da Vinci. Be prepared for the crowds surrounding this small yet captivating painting, as visitors from around the world flock to catch a glimpse of her enigmatic smile.
Aside from the Mona Lisa, don’t miss other iconic works such as the Venus de Milo, Winged Victory of Samothrace, and Liberty Leading the People. Each piece tells a unique story and offers a glimpse into different periods of art history.
